Qualifications:



  • You must have passed your NCLEX no later than 3/15/2023 in advance of the 4/3/2023 start date. It is preferred if you have your current and active California registered nurse license before the application date.
  • You must have less than nine months of acute care hospital-based experience as a licensed RN prior to the start of the program.
  • You need at least an ADN, Bachelor's degree in nursing is preferred.
  • You must have completed your nursing program within the last 12 months when you apply.
  • You need a current and active Basic Life Support (BLS) certification for healthcare providers from the American Heart Association or American Red Cross.
